The problem

Looking for a job is a full time job with no manager, no process, and no feedback loop. People rewrite the same resume twenty times, lose track of where they applied, and never really know if a role is worth the effort before they have already spent an evening on it. The advice online is generic. Most tools stop at "here is a list of jobs."

What it does

Jobtune treats one job hunt as one operation. You point it at the roles you actually care about and it does the heavy lifting around each one.

  • Reads a role and reads you. It looks at a job and tells you how well you fit before you invest time, so you chase the right ones.
  • Tailors the resume to the role. Not a template swap. A version written for that specific job, ready to send.
  • Builds an apply kit. Everything you need to apply well in one place, so applying takes minutes instead of an evening.
  • Keeps the whole search in one tracker. What you targeted, what stage it is at, what is next. No more spreadsheet held together with hope.
  • Gives you a public profile. A clean, shareable page at your own handle that you can hand to a recruiter instead of a PDF.
How I thought about it

The core decision was to stop treating job hunting as a feed of listings and start treating it as a small portfolio of targets you manage. Once you have that spine, everything else hangs off it: ranking, tailoring, tracking, follow ups. The product gets out of your way and lets you spend your energy on the few roles that matter.

The other rule was honesty. The tool tells you when a role is a stretch. A career product that only ever says "go for it" is just noise, and people can feel that.

The problem

Vedic astrology is one of the oldest decision frameworks people still use, and most of the digital versions of it are bad. They are either vague horoscope filler with no real chart behind them, or technically correct but written in a language only a practitioner can read. If you actually want to understand your own chart, your options are a pricey one to one consult or a wall of jargon.

What it does
  • Builds your real chart. Astronomically accurate, the way a serious practitioner would expect, not a generic sun sign.
  • Explains it in plain language. What the chart is saying, written so a first timer gets it without losing what makes the tradition real.
  • Answers your actual questions. You can ask a specific question and get a grounded, chart based reading, not a fortune cookie.
  • Stays current. Readings account for where things stand today, not a frozen snapshot.
  • Respects the source. It works inside classical Vedic method rather than blending in whatever sounds nice.
How I thought about it

The whole product lives or dies on trust. An astrology app that quietly makes things up is worse than useless to the people who care about this, because they will catch it. So the bar I set was simple: the chart has to be correct first, and the explanation has to stay faithful to what the chart actually says. Get those two right and the writing can be warm and readable without becoming fiction.

The second call was format. A consult is a conversation, not a report. So Astrika lets you ask, not just read, which is what people were really looking for all along.

Fintech · United States and Malaysia

MoneyLion

Insurance, payments, and an ad engine inside Copilot.

I built and lead a business unit across two teams in the US and Malaysia, for a platform of 23M+ users. The signature build is an industry-first advertising engine embedded inside Microsoft Copilot, where the conversation itself becomes a channel that drives clicks and revenue.

Logistics SaaS · B2B

Intugine · ePOD and Control Center

Predictive logistics in a single dashboard.

Built ePOD, an electronic proof of delivery product, and Control Center, a machine-learning platform that predicts delivery timelines, calculates rates, and tracks shipments in one place. Used by enterprise fleets, and backed by a bank for bill discounting for trucking companies.

Payments · India

SabPaisa · Split Calculator

The end of manual settlement.

Built Split Calculator, an automated reconciliation product that replaced a fully manual settlement process. I also led the product rebuild through the RBI licensing process, so compliance was designed in rather than bolted on.
